Centric (CNR/CNS) Announces Migration to Binance Smart Chain

PRESS RELEASE. London, UK — Centric announced an upcoming fork to the Binance Smart Chain (BSC), after almost 2.5 years on the TRON blockchain. Centric’s tokens, Centric Cash (CNS) and Centric Rise (CNR), will move to the BEP-20 token standard native to the Binance Smart Chain.

Before deciding to switch, Clelland said the team consulted the ten centralized exchanges listing CNS.

“We discovered most already integrate with the Binance Smart Chain. The overwhelming support and cooperation of the exchanges increased our confidence in executing the switch with minimal disruption,” said Clelland.

The rising cost per transaction on TRON over the past year provided another motivation for the move. In contrast to TRON, the cost per transaction on BSC has stayed the same or decreased, even while the price of Binance Coin (BNB) rose sharply starting in January.

Centric Cash (CNS) will be renamed to Centric Swap, as the new name better reflects the token’s utility as the on-ramp to the Centric network, and the off-ramp to liquidity. CNS will keep the CNS ticker. The name and ticker of Centric Rise (CNR) will remain unchanged.

Centric’s developers are building out a conversion tool to execute a 1:1 swap between the TRC-20 tokens and the new BEP-20 tokens. CNS held on exchanges at the time of the switch will automatically convert, as will all CNR held in Centric’s native wallet. Users with CNR or CNS in an external wallet will have access to the conversion tool as well.

About Centric

Centric was conceived with the vision of one day replacing traditional fiat currencies. Blockchain technology will enable a more transparent world and we believe our innovative approach to achieving widespread adoption long-term sets Centric apart from other cryptocurrencies today.

Centric believes the largest obstacle to the mass adoption of cryptocurrencies is price volatility. Cryptocurrencies, unlike fiat currencies, do not have a central bank to implement monetary policy focused on stabilizing purchasing power. Thus, changes in demand induce massive price fluctuations. The decentralized model to price discovery has made the majority of existing cryptocurrencies nothing more than stocks or commodities, valued on psychology, traded on unregulated stock markets, and susceptible to manipulation. The lack of price stability has prevented credit and debt markets from forming because volatility incurs a premium.

While the rest of the industry focuses on transaction throughput and smart contracts, Centric focus on solving price stability to realize the economic capabilities that the blockchain enables.
